Assessing Existing Pipes Solutions



Examining existing plumbing systems is an important step in any shower room installment project. A complete assessment permits plumbings to determine potential problems that may emerge during extensions or improvements. This evaluation consists of evaluating pipelines for leakages, rust, or obstructions and evaluating water pressure and flow rates.Plumbers additionally check out the water drainage system to validate it can manage the extra load from brand-new components. Comprehending the present layout and condition of the pipes aids in establishing essential upgrades or modifications.Additionally, plumbing professionals examine conformity with local building codes and laws, validating that any kind of adjustments made fulfill security requirements. This careful exam not just protects against pricey problems yet also ensures that the new washroom functions successfully and properly. By attending to existing plumbing difficulties upfront, plumbers play a crucial role in promoting a successful washroom installation procedure, ultimately causing a much more enjoyable outcome for homeowners.

Making Certain Leak-Free Links



Guaranteeing leak-free links during the setup of installations and fixtures is important for an effective shower room project. Plumbings ace plumbing play a vital function by meticulously inspecting all joints and connections throughout the installation procedure. They use high-grade products such as Teflon tape and proper sealants to stop leakages, ensuring that water flows just where meant. Each connection needs to be tightened to precise specifications to avoid future issues. In addition, plumbing technicians conduct comprehensive inspections after installment, testing components under pressure to determine any possible leaks. This aggressive technique not only safeguards versus water damage however additionally enhances the long life of the plumbing system. Eventually, their knowledge assures a trustworthy and efficient shower room arrangement, offering assurance for homeowners.


Taking Care Of Supply Of Water and Drainage



Reliable management of supply of water and water drainage is necessary for a successful restroom setup (Maintenance Stoke-On-Trent). An experienced plumbing professional analyzes the existing pipes infrastructure to identify the most effective design for brand-new components. This consists of calculating water pressure and guaranteeing appropriate supply lines for sinks, toilets, and showers. Appropriate drain is similarly vital; the plumber must mount waste pipes at the correct slope to facilitate smooth water flow and protect against clogs.Additionally, the plumbing has to pick appropriate products, such as PVC or copper, based on local building ordinance and the particular needs of the shower room design. They likewise think about the proximity of the bathroom to the major water drainage system to decrease possible problems. By diligently intending and performing the pipes configuration, the plumbing technician plays an essential function in preventing future plumbing issues and making certain that the restroom works appropriately for many years to come


Last Examinations and Upkeep Tips



Finishing a restroom setup calls for complete final examinations to validate every little thing functions as intended. try here A qualified plumbing technician will certainly examine all installments, including taps, toilets, and shower systems, seeing to it there are no leakages, clogs, or improper installations. This step is vital for preventing future problems that might arise from undetected errors.After the setup, routine maintenance is important. Home owners should regularly look for leaks around fixtures and examine caulking for wear. Cleansing drains with a mixture of baking soda and vinegar can aid protect against accumulation and clogs. It is recommended to purge toilets and run taps frequently to guarantee they remain in excellent working order.Additionally, a plumbing professional might recommend scheduling yearly assessments to capture any type of potential problems early. By complying with these upkeep pointers and carrying out detailed final inspections, home owners can enjoy a effective and functional bathroom for years to find.
